This is a lovely homefront pennant meant for use during the Victory Day parades as well as to welcome home the incoming troops. The frame measrues 19 x 38 and the pennant is in fantastic condition, looking to have never seen use. The pennant has a small circle in the top canton with Uncle Sam standing around soldiers and female workers, with the caption WELL DONE MY BOYS. A great piece for any WWII collection. Ready
